Description

The First World War was one of the largest, in terms of spread and duration, wars in history. Approximately 70 million men participated in it, of whom about 10 million were non-Europeans. Approximately 16.5 million were dead.
This book tells the story of this cataclysmic event, describing the background, international rivalries, and conflicts of the previous decades that led to the formation of opposing camps among the nations of Europe, the relentless escalation of the arms race at the beginning of the 20th century, the prominent figures who tried to prevent its outbreak or, on the contrary, enthusiastically sought its provocation.
It is an excellent introduction to the events of this decisive historical phase, complemented by an informative Epilogue on the Greek involvement in this conflict, by the academic Elli Lemonidou.
